As the first nineteenth century woman to successfully campaign for
women's rights legislation, Caroline Norton has been comparatively
neglected and under-researched. There is, however, a current and
growing interest in her life and work. This is a new three volume
collection of the correspondence of Caroline Norton. The collection
includes over 750 of her letters and also features an introduction
by the editors, contextualising and embedding Caroline's literary
and political achievements within the narrative of her letters.
